Journey to Jazz 2025: Explore Jazz in the Heart of Prince Albert

The Journey to Jazz festival, held by the Prince Albert Community Trust, is a yearly celebration of music and community upliftment. The celebration features live performances, music masterclasses,  local cuisine, stargazing, sunrise yoga and more. Here’s everything you need to know about the 2025 edition of the festival.

About Journey to Jazz

Journey to Jazz is a true Karoo festival celebrating the rich history, art, and natural beauty of Prince Albert. Set at the foot of the Swartberg Mountains, the intimate event features local and international artists performing across the town. Visitors enjoy music, masterclasses, local cuisine, stargazing, sunrise yoga, and time exploring the Wolvekraal conservancy.

A project of the Prince Albert Community Trust, Journey to Jazz showcases the talent and dedication of local youth who crew the festival and who have been trained in hospitality, event management, and media. It’s a heartfelt celebration of community and culture, welcoming guests to the true spirit of the Karoo.

The Prince Albert Community Trust is a non-profit organisation, focused on empowering children and youth, from early childhood development to entering the workforce. Through arts, culture, and education, the Trust fosters personal growth, social justice, and economic equality.

What’s On at Journey to Jazz

The 2025 edition of Journey to Jazz hosts multiple exciting performers, with the festival being opened by the Zolani Youth Choir, who won the Grand Prix at the 2024 A Cappella Moscow Music Competition. The choir aims to elevate South African choral music, empowering youth and promoting community upliftment

Meanwhile, the opening ceremony is handled by the People’s Concert, a collection of bands and artists of various genres. The ceremony is held at the Kritikom Koppie Theatre, a former disused and abandoned quarry, that has been lovingly restored by the town into a stunning amphitheatre.

Other performing artists include the Kyle Shepherd Trio, Ernie Smith, the Outeniqua High School Jazz Band, and the Paolo Damiani Last Land Band, who are based in Italy.

There are also various music masterclasses throughout the event, which involve understanding jazz, the art of a trio, and embracing the voice within you. The festival promises to be an uplifting and exciting look into the world of jazz.

How to Book Tickets

Each event is priced differently, and all events can be booked through Quicket.

When: 30 April – 4 May 2025
Where: Various venues across Prince Albert
